依次处理每个颜色序号为
.的格子,从颜色1往后枚举到一个最小的不会重复的颜色#include<bits/stdc++.h> using namespace std; const int N = 710; char ch[N][N]; int main() { int h, w; cin >> h >> w; for (int i = 1; i <= h; i++) for (int j = 1; j <= w; j++) cin >> ch[i][j]; for (int i = 1; i <= h; i++) for (int j = 1; j <= w; j++) { if (ch[i][j] != '.') continue; int a = ch[i - 1][j] - '0', b = ch[i][j - 1] - '0', c = ch[i + 1][j] - '0', d = ch[i][j + 1] - '0'; int id = 1; while (id == a or id == b or id == c or id == d) id++; ch[i][j] = id + '0'; } for (int i = 1; i <= h; i++) { for (int j = 1; j <= w; j++) cout << ch[i][j]; cout << '\n'; } return 0; } -
